[Terminé] Twin breaker

Animapix
Messages : 5
Inscription : 14 Oct 2019 21:09

[Terminé] Twin breaker

Message par Animapix » 15 Oct 2019 10:15

Bonjour à tous,

voici mon premier prototype de jeux.
Le concept est une sorte de de casse brique à l'horizontal avec deux raquettes, la balle prend la couleur de la raquette qu'elle viens de toucher et peut casser les briques uniquement de la même couleur. Pour le moment j'ai fait le minimum pour tester le gameplay avant d'ajouter plus de comportements. Pour être claire, je ne suis pas encore certain que la boucle de gameplay soit vraiment interessante.
Pour le moment je voudrais ajouter la possibilité de diriger la balle avec la raquette, et j'ai un problème plus compliqué à gérer, la balle ce coince parfois et fait des rebond de haut en bas. Je cherche un moyen simple de régler ce défaut, j'ai penser a utiliser la graviter pour forcer la balle à rejoindre la raquette adverse, qu'en pensez-vous ?

Merci d'avance pour vos retours


https://www.youtube.com/watch?v=rgmpDq6lAhA
Dernière édition par Animapix le 09 Nov 2019 10:28, édité 2 fois.

Avatar de l’utilisateur
Alesk
Messages : 2303
Inscription : 13 Mars 2012 09:09
Localisation : Bordeaux - France
Contact :

Re: [WIP] Twin breaker

Message par Alesk » 15 Oct 2019 11:38

Salut,

Un moyen "simple" pour régler ton souci serait d'ajouter un tout petit peu de random dans la trajectoire de ta balle quand sa vélocité sur X ou Y est égale à zéro et qu'elle n'a pas touché de raquette depuis au moins 2 rebonds.

Animapix
Messages : 5
Inscription : 14 Oct 2019 21:09

Re: [WIP] Twin breaker

Message par Animapix » 15 Oct 2019 23:03

Bonsoir les amis,

Merci Alesk pour ton aide précieuse, ta solution est simple et efficace, j'ai ajouté un compteur de collisions qui se réinitialise à chaque collision avec les raquettes, si ce compteur passe un certain nombre et que la balle n'a pas une vélocité assez importante sur x, j'ajoute un peu de random dans la trajectoire.

Pour le reste j'ai ajouté le contrôle de trajectoire avec les raquettes et j'ai aussi ajouté le changement de couleur de la brique si elle ne correspond pas avec la balle. Concrètement le gameplay est beaucoup plus sympa grâce à ces améliorations. J'ai aussi testé le changement de couleur des particules en fonction de la couleur de la brique.

Pour le moment je suis plutôt satisfait, je vais donc continuer avec le système de comptage de points et les combos.

Encore merci pour ton aide Alesk et merci pour votre lecture

https://www.youtube.com/watch?v=pWLJVy2Oq_s

Avatar de l’utilisateur
Alesk
Messages : 2303
Inscription : 13 Mars 2012 09:09
Localisation : Bordeaux - France
Contact :

Re: [WIP] Twin breaker

Message par Alesk » 16 Oct 2019 10:05

Cool !

Bon par contre il va falloir trouver une solution pour la fin de partie, car là ça peut durer des siècles avant d'éliminer les deux derniers blocs :gene:

Sinon, pour le déplacement de la balle, si jamais tu veux la faire aller plus (bcp) vite, si sa vélocité est trop élevée il se peut qu'elle passe au travers des obstacles.
Dans ce cas la solution est de calculer à l'avance la trajectoire et les impacts avec des raycasts. Si ce problème survient je pourrais te donner plus de détails sur comment gérer ça, si besoin.

Animapix
Messages : 5
Inscription : 14 Oct 2019 21:09

Re: [WIP] Twin breaker

Message par Animapix » 09 Nov 2019 01:55

Bonsoir à tous,

J'ai eu beaucoup de travail ces derniers temps ce qui ma poussé à délaisser mon petit jeu. J'ai repris avec plaisir cette semaine, et j'ai intégré une petit interface utilisateur et une boucle de jeu avec plusieurs niveaux.

Je te remercie Alesk pour ton aide sur les raycasts, mais je ne vais pas aller plus loin sur cet exercice qui était pour moi uniquement une première expérience sur Unity.

J'ai appris énormément de choses grâce a ce premier petit projet et je ne pense pas en rester là, j'ai déjà une ou deux idée à tester avant de me lancer dans un projet plus long et plus exigent en therme des compétences.

Merci pour ton aide et merci à tous pour la lecture de ce sujet.

Pour finir voici une petite vidéo des mon jeu en l'état.
https://www.youtube.com/watch?v=Rw1hxJyb9Eg

Avatar de l’utilisateur
Alesk
Messages : 2303
Inscription : 13 Mars 2012 09:09
Localisation : Bordeaux - France
Contact :

Re: [WIP] Twin breaker

Message par Alesk » 09 Nov 2019 10:03

Félicitations :super:

Répondre

Revenir vers « Vos créations, jeux, démos... »